Family of Darius before Alexander. Le Brun, Charles (French, 1619-1690) (designed after) [painter] c. 1720 Tapestry Dimensions: H 9'11" x W 12' Tapestry Materials/Techniques: unknown Culture: French Weaving Center: Aubusson Ownership History: French & Co. received from Mrs. S. G. Rosenbaum, 2/11/1941; returned 2/16/1954. Inscriptions: City mark in lower guard, right: / ... AUBUSSON.../ Alexander accompanied by Hephaestion, both in armor with plumed helmets (L), stand before the family of Darius; family members, with child, kneeling, some prostrate before Alexander under tent; additional tents with guard in background (L) (BRD) picture-frame border with stylized scallop motifs centered with acanthus leaves & superimposed on trellis ground with flower heads The lower guard features, besides the AUBUSSON city mark, additional inscriptions. However, they are faint & hard to decipher. It is probable that a weaver's signature appears on the lower guard. French & Co. stock sheet in archive, 75061 Saunier, Lisses et délices (1996), 221-23 Chevalier, Aubusson (1988), 81 Related Works: Panels in set: GCPA 0243265, 0243274; compositionally similar tapestries (with variations): GCPA 0237555, 0241859-0241862, 0241864, 0241871, 0241873, 0243266-0243267, 0243269, "La Tente de Darius" Château de Chaumont-sur-Loire (Saunier, p. 221), "La Tente de Darius" Musée des Beaux-Arts, Niort (Chevalier, p. 81)
